Home
last modified time | relevance | path

Searched refs:pdev_priv_obj (Results 1 – 11 of 11) sorted by relevance

/wlan-driver/qca-wifi-host-cmn/umac/regulatory/core/src/
Dreg_priv_objs.c200 reg_reset_unii_5g_bitmap(stru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j) in reg_reset_unii_5g_bitmap() argument
202 pdev_priv_obj->unii_5g_bitmap = 0x0; in reg_reset_unii_5g_bitmap()
206 reg_reset_unii_5g_bitmap(stru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j) in reg_reset_unii_5g_bitmap() argument
221 reg_init_def_client_type(stru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j) in reg_init_def_client_type() argument
223 pdev_priv_obj->reg_cur_6g_client_mobility_type = REG_DEFAULT_CLIENT; in reg_init_def_client_type()
227 reg_init_def_client_type(stru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j) in reg_init_def_client_type() argument
229 pdev_priv_obj->reg_cur_6g_client_mobility_type = REG_SUBORDINATE_CLIENT; in reg_init_def_client_type()
242 reg_init_6g_vars(stru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j) in reg_init_6g_vars() argument
244 reg_set_ap_pwr_type(pdev_priv_obj); in reg_init_6g_vars()
245 pdev_priv_obj->reg_rnr_tpe_usable = false; in reg_init_6g_vars()
[all …]
Dreg_build_chan_list.c470 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j, in reg_get_connected_chan_for_mode() argument
479 pdev = pdev_priv_obj->pdev_ptr; in reg_get_connected_chan_for_mode()
513 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j, in reg_get_active_6ghz_freq_range_with_fcc_set() argument
521 start_freq_6g = pdev_priv_obj->cur_chan_list[MIN_6GHZ_CHANNEL].center_freq; in reg_get_active_6ghz_freq_range_with_fcc_set()
522 end_freq_6g = pdev_priv_obj->cur_chan_list[MAX_6GHZ_CHANNEL].center_freq; in reg_get_active_6ghz_freq_range_with_fcc_set()
524 conn_chan_sta = reg_get_connected_chan_for_mode(pdev_priv_obj, in reg_get_active_6ghz_freq_range_with_fcc_set()
529 conn_chan_cli = reg_get_connected_chan_for_mode(pdev_priv_obj, in reg_get_active_6ghz_freq_range_with_fcc_set()
543 conn_chan = reg_get_connected_chan_for_mode(pdev_priv_obj, in reg_get_active_6ghz_freq_range_with_fcc_set()
550 conn_chan = reg_get_connected_chan_for_mode(pdev_priv_obj, in reg_get_active_6ghz_freq_range_with_fcc_set()
580 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j, in reg_get_connected_chan_for_mode() argument
[all …]
Dreg_utils.c49 #define IS_VALID_PDEV_REG_OBJ(pdev_priv_obj) (pdev_priv_obj) argument
56 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j; in reg_chan_has_dfs_attribute_for_freq() local
63 pdev_priv_obj = reg_get_pdev_obj(pdev); in reg_chan_has_dfs_attribute_for_freq()
65 if (!IS_VALID_PDEV_REG_OBJ(pdev_priv_obj)) { in reg_chan_has_dfs_attribute_for_freq()
70 if (pdev_priv_obj->cur_chan_list[ch_idx].chan_flags & in reg_chan_has_dfs_attribute_for_freq()
202 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j; in reg_set_non_offload_country() local
227 pdev_priv_obj = reg_get_pdev_obj(pdev); in reg_set_non_offload_country()
228 if (!IS_VALID_PDEV_REG_OBJ(pdev_priv_obj)) { in reg_set_non_offload_country()
233 if (reg_is_world_ctry_code(pdev_priv_obj->def_region_domain)) in reg_set_non_offload_country()
235 pdev_priv_obj->def_region_domain; in reg_set_non_offload_country()
[all …]
Dreg_services_common.c1573 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j; in reg_get_current_dfs_region() local
1575 pdev_priv_obj = reg_get_pdev_obj(pdev); in reg_get_current_dfs_region()
1576 if (!IS_VALID_PDEV_REG_OBJ(pdev_priv_obj)) { in reg_get_current_dfs_region()
1581 *dfs_reg = pdev_priv_obj->dfs_region; in reg_get_current_dfs_region()
1587 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j; in reg_set_dfs_region() local
1589 pdev_priv_obj = reg_get_pdev_obj(pdev); in reg_set_dfs_region()
1590 if (!IS_VALID_PDEV_REG_OBJ(pdev_priv_obj)) { in reg_set_dfs_region()
1595 pdev_priv_obj->dfs_region = dfs_reg; in reg_set_dfs_region()
1672 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j; in reg_freq_to_chan() local
1681 pdev_priv_obj = reg_get_pdev_obj(pdev); in reg_freq_to_chan()
[all …]
Dreg_callbacks.c51 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j; in reg_call_chan_change_cbks() local
64 pdev_priv_obj = reg_get_pdev_obj(pdev); in reg_call_chan_change_cbks()
65 if (!IS_VALID_PDEV_REG_OBJ(pdev_priv_obj)) { in reg_call_chan_change_cbks()
240 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j; in reg_send_scheduler_msg_sb() local
243 pdev_priv_obj = reg_get_pdev_obj(pdev); in reg_send_scheduler_msg_sb()
244 if (!IS_VALID_PDEV_REG_OBJ(pdev_priv_obj)) { in reg_send_scheduler_msg_sb()
249 if (!pdev_priv_obj->pdev_opened) { in reg_send_scheduler_msg_sb()
254 if (!pdev_priv_obj->chan_list_recvd) { in reg_send_scheduler_msg_sb()
301 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j; in reg_send_scheduler_msg_nb() local
304 pdev_priv_obj = reg_get_pdev_obj(pdev); in reg_send_scheduler_msg_nb()
[all …]
Dreg_build_chan_list.h69 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j,
79 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j);
86 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j);
132 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j,
259 void reg_set_ap_pwr_type(stru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j);
276 *pdev_priv_obj,
291 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j, in reg_get_reg_maschan_lst_frm_6g_pwr_mode() argument
336 reg_set_ap_pwr_type(stru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j) in reg_set_ap_pwr_type() argument
342 *pdev_priv_obj, in reg_get_6g_pwrmode_chan_list()
Dreg_lte.c147 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j; in reg_update_unsafe_ch() local
156 pdev_priv_obj = reg_get_pdev_obj(pdev); in reg_update_unsafe_ch()
158 if (!IS_VALID_PDEV_REG_OBJ(pdev_priv_obj)) { in reg_update_unsafe_ch()
169 reg_compute_pdev_current_chan_list(pdev_priv_obj); in reg_update_unsafe_ch()
Dreg_opclass.c1303 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j; in reg_freq_to_chan_op_class() local
1306 pdev_priv_obj = reg_get_pdev_obj(pdev); in reg_freq_to_chan_op_class()
1308 if (!IS_VALID_PDEV_REG_OBJ(pdev_priv_obj)) { in reg_freq_to_chan_op_class()
1313 cur_chan_list = pdev_priv_obj->cur_chan_list; in reg_freq_to_chan_op_class()
2240 reg_enable_disable_chan_in_mas_chan_list(stru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j, in reg_enable_disable_chan_in_mas_chan_list() argument
2248 freq = reg_legacy_chan_to_freq(pdev_priv_obj->pdev_ptr, chan_num); in reg_enable_disable_chan_in_mas_chan_list()
2266 mas_chan_list = pdev_priv_obj->mas_chan_list; in reg_enable_disable_chan_in_mas_chan_list()
2294 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j; in reg_enable_disable_chan_freq() local
2296 pdev_priv_obj = reg_get_pdev_obj(pdev); in reg_enable_disable_chan_freq()
2297 if (!pdev_priv_obj) { in reg_enable_disable_chan_freq()
[all …]
Dreg_priv_objs.h562 reg_free_afc_pwr_info(stru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j);
565 reg_free_afc_pwr_info(stru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j) in reg_free_afc_pwr_info() argument
Dreg_services_common.h35 #define IS_VALID_PDEV_REG_OBJ(pdev_priv_obj) (pdev_priv_obj) argument
/wlan-driver/qca-wifi-host-cmn/umac/regulatory/dispatcher/src/
Dwlan_reg_services_api.c585 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j; in regulatory_pdev_open() local
587 pdev_priv_obj = reg_get_pdev_obj(pdev); in regulatory_pdev_open()
589 if (!IS_VALID_PDEV_REG_OBJ(pdev_priv_obj)) { in regulatory_pdev_open()
594 pdev_priv_obj->pdev_opened = true; in regulatory_pdev_open()
610 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j; in regulatory_pdev_close() local
612 pdev_priv_obj = reg_get_pdev_obj(pdev); in regulatory_pdev_close()
613 if (!IS_VALID_PDEV_REG_OBJ(pdev_priv_obj)) { in regulatory_pdev_close()
618 pdev_priv_obj->pdev_opened = false; in regulatory_pdev_close()
751 struct wlan_regulatory_pdev_priv_obj *pdev_priv_obj; in wlan_reg_get_chip_mode() local
753 pdev_priv_obj = wlan_objmgr_pdev_get_comp_private_obj(pdev, in wlan_reg_get_chip_mode()
[all …]